The Evolution of User-Generated Content


Content created by users has revolutionized the landscape of online gaming, fostering imagination and collaboration among players. It originated with easy mods and custom maps in early franchise games, where dedicated players modified existing titles to boost gameplay or bring in new elements. As tech progressed, so did the tools available for creating content, allowing a larger audience to participate in game design. This shift permitted players not only to experience but also to participate actively to the gaming environment.


The rise of services that support user-generated creations represented a major milestone in the development of online gaming. Titles like Minecraft and Roblox provided strong environments where players could create their own virtual worlds and experiences. These platforms democratized game development, making it accessible to anyone with a creative idea. As a result, entire communities formed around joint game-making, where users could discuss, play, and iterate on each other’s creations, leading to groundbreaking gameplay concepts and storylines that might never have developed from traditional development studios.
